PIC10F200-I/P 8-Bit Flash Microcontroller DIP-8 (PIC10F200-I/P DIP IC)
The PIC10F200-I/P is one of the smallest and most cost-effective 8-bit microcontrollers available in a 8-pin DIP package. It is based on a high-performance RISC CPU and features an extremely simple architecture with only 33 single-word instructions. This IC includes 256 words of Flash program memory and 16 bytes of RAM. It is designed for applications requiring minimal board space and low power consumption, making it an ideal choice for basic timing, logic replacement, and simple state machines where a full-sized microcontroller would be overkill.
This IC is primarily used in low-cost consumer electronics, pulse width modulation (PWM) tasks, and simple sensor interfacing. It is a popular component for Arduino electronics projects in India for building tiny DIY gadgets, LED blinkers, power-on delay circuits, and learning assembly language programming on a minimalist platform.
Key Features
- High-performance RISC CPU with 33 instructions
- Internal 4MHz RC oscillator (precision calibrated)
- In-Circuit Serial Programming (ICSP) support
- Wide operating voltage range (2.0V to 5.5V)
- Extremely low power consumption (under 1uA standby at 2V)
- 8-bit real-time clock/counter (TMR0) with 8-bit programmable prescaler
- Watchdog Timer (WDT) with independent on-chip RC oscillator
- High current source/sink for direct LED drive
Specifications
- IC Type = 8-Bit Flash Microcontroller
- Program Memory = 256 Words (384 Bytes)
- Data RAM = 16 Bytes
- Speed = 4MHz (Internal Oscillator)
- I/O Pins = 4 (3 I/O, 1 Input-only)
- Supply Voltage = 2.0V to 5.5V
- Current Sink/Source = 25mA
- Package Type = PDIP-8
- Number of Pins = 8
- Mounting Type = Through-Hole
- Operating Temperature = -40 to 85 degrees Celsius
Interfaces
- PIN 1 (GP2/T0CKI/FOSC4) = General Purpose I/O / Timer Clock Input
- PIN 2 (VDD) = Positive Supply Voltage (2.0V-5.5V)
- PIN 3 (GP3/MCLR/VPP) = Input Only / Master Clear / Programming Voltage
- PIN 4 (GP0/ICSPDAT) = General Purpose I/O / Programming Data
- PIN 5 (GP1/ICSPCLK) = General Purpose I/O / Programming Clock
- PIN 7 (VSS) = Ground (0V)
- PIN 6, 8 (NC) = No Connection